湛江师范学院08-09信科院微机原理与接口技术考试A卷.doc

上传人:scccc 文档编号:12276693 上传时间:2021-12-02 格式:DOC 页数:7 大小:91.50KB
返回 下载 相关 举报
湛江师范学院08-09信科院微机原理与接口技术考试A卷.doc_第1页
第1页 / 共7页
湛江师范学院08-09信科院微机原理与接口技术考试A卷.doc_第2页
第2页 / 共7页
湛江师范学院08-09信科院微机原理与接口技术考试A卷.doc_第3页
第3页 / 共7页
亲,该文档总共7页,到这儿已超出免费预览范围,如果喜欢就下载吧!
资源描述

《湛江师范学院08-09信科院微机原理与接口技术考试A卷.doc》由会员分享,可在线阅读,更多相关《湛江师范学院08-09信科院微机原理与接口技术考试A卷.doc(7页珍藏版)》请在三一文库上搜索。

1、湛江师范学院 2008 年 2009 学年度第二学期 期末考试试题 A 卷一、单项选择题1.8086CPU在执行MOXAL, BX指令的总线周期内, 若BX存放的内容为 2034H, BHE#和A的状态为(D )。A. 0,1B. 0,0C. 1,12 8086 工作在最小模式下,当A. 存储器读D. 1,0M/IO#=0,B. I/ORD#=Q WR#=1时,CPU完成的操作读是( B ) 。C. 存储器写D. I/O3.构成4KB的存储器系统,需用A. 1024X4 位的芯片 8 片 B.A )。2KX1 位的芯片 8 片C. 1024X8位的芯片2片D.16KX1位的芯片4片5.在825

2、9A中,寄存器IMR的作用是A. 记录处理的中断请求( D ) 。B. 判断中断优先级的级别C. 存放外部输入的中断请求信号D. 有选择的屏蔽6用 intel8259A 作为中断控制器时,为( C ) 。要用它来清除中断请求,以防止重复进入中断程序 要用它来屏蔽已被服务了的中断源,使其不再发出请求 要用它来清除中断服务寄存器中的相应位,以允许同级或较低级中断能被服 要用它来重新配置 8259A 中断控制器在外部可屏蔽中断的服务程序中,要用EOI 命令( 中断结束命令 )是因A.B.C.D.7A.从硬件角度而言,采用硬件最少的数据传送方式是DMA 控制( B )。B. 无条件传送C.查选传送D.

3、中断传送8A.8086CPU接收到中断类型码后,将它 左移 2 位B.( A ) 位,形成中断向量的起始地址。 左移 4 位C.右移 2 位D.右移 4 位9A.对8255A的C 口执行按位置位/复位操作时,写入的端口地址是(D端口 AB.端口 B)。B.C.端口 CD. 控制端口10.当8255A端口 PA PB分别工作在方式 2、方式1时,其PC端口为(A. 2 位 I/OB. 2个 4 位 I/O)。C. 全部作应答联络线D. 1个 8 位 I/O1 1 内部中断的中断类型码是由A. 外设提供B.) 接口电路提供C. 指令提供或预先设置D. I/O端口提供128251A 以异步通信方式工

4、作, 则传输速率为 ( D ) 。字符长度为 7 位, 1 位校验位,停止位为2 位,每秒钟可传输 240 个字符,A. 240b/sB. 2200b/sC. 输出信号保持原来的电位值 D.立即开始计数14把模拟量信号转换为数字信号中,A. 量化B.A/D 转换就是 ( A )的过程。 保持C. 采样D.编码15设有已被测量温度的变化范围为0 c -100 C,要求测量误差不超过0.1 C,则应选用 A/D转换器的分辨率至少应该为 ( C ) 。A. 4 位 B. 8 位C. 10位 D. 12 位16. 8255A的引脚CS# RD# WR信号电平分别为(B )时,可完成“数据总线宀 825

5、5A数据寄存器” 的操作。A. 1 、1、 0B. 0 、1、0 C. 0、 0、 1D.1、 0、 117可编程串行通信接口芯片A. 仅支持同步传送16550( B )。B. 仅支持异步传送C. 支持同步传送和异步传送D. 也支持并行传送188254 工作在方式 3,A. N+1个CLK时钟周期计数初值是B. N-1N, OUT端输出的方波周期是(D ) 之和。 个CLK时钟周期C. N/2个CLK时钟周期D. N个CLK时钟周期19 响应可屏蔽中断后,A. 保存断点后8086CPU是在(C ) 读取中断向量号。B. 第一个中断响应周期C. 第二个中断响应周期D. T4 前沿13.当 825

6、4(3) 可编程定时 / 计数器工作在方式 0,在初始化编程时,一旦写入控制字后,输出信号端OUT变为低电平A.输出信号端OUT变为高电平B.20.计算机与外设之间的串行通信,实际是 ( A )I/O 接口与外设串行I/O 接口与外设并行 I/O 接口与外设串行I/O 接口与外设并行A. CPU 与 I/O 接口并行,B. CPU 与 I/O 接口并行,C. CPU 与 I/O 接口串行,D. CPU 与 I/O 接口串行,二、多项选择题1. 8086/8088CPU 工作在最小模式下对存储器进行写操作有关的控制信号是 ( ABCE )A. M/IO# B. WR# C. ALE D. INT

7、A# E. DT/R#2. 8254计数器/定时器当计数结束时,OUT端可输出一个宽度为CLK时钟周期的负脉冲的工作方式有( BDE )A. 方式 1 B. 方式 2 C. 方式 3 D. 方式 4 E. 方式 53. 8086/8088CPU 响应不可屏蔽中断 NMI 过程中所做的工作有 ( BDEF )A. 在 DB 上读取中断类型码B. 将当前标志寄存器 F的内容入栈C. 将 IF 、 TF 位清“ 0”D. 保护断点E. 保护现场F. 中断服务程序的入口地址送入CS IP4. 对可编程控制串行接口芯片16550 进行初始化时,主要是对 ( ACDEF)进行设置。A. 通信线控制寄存器B

8、. 通信线状态寄存器 C. 除数寄存器D.FIFO控制寄存器E.中断允许寄存器F. MODEM控制寄存器G.MODE状态寄存器H.中断识别寄存器5.用异步方式通信,8251A设置了哪几种检错标志(ABCDE )A.奇/偶校验错B.帧格式错 C. 溢出错D.数据覆盖错E.数据格式错三、判断题1.若已知定时时间为T,输入CLK寸钟周期为t,则定时器的计数初值=t/T ( X )2内部中断的优先级高于外部中断的优先级。(X )3存储器芯片的片选信号采用部分译码方式一定会产生地址重叠区。(V ) 4串行通信中,异步方式就是字符与字符之间、字符内部位与位之间均为异步。5. 8254计数器的CLK端每当输

9、入一个脉冲信号后,CE就加“ 1”计数。(6. 8255A的PAD、BP口和PC口都可以作为8位I/O数据端口。 ( X )ISR相应位置“ T,同时向7. 8259A工作于全嵌套方式,每当外设有请求,其就会选出优先级最高的,对“INT” 请求。(X )8. 8088/8086CPU在响应内部中断时,均不执行中断响应总线周期。( V )9. 8254初始化,写入计数初值一定要在写入控制字之后进行。( X )10. 串行异步通信两个字符之间可以是任意长度,可以是高电平,也可以是低电平。(V)四、填空题(每空1分,共10分)1. 8254中某个计数器工作在方式3,若输入时钟 CLK为1MH,要求O

10、UT输出频率为20000HZ的方波,那么写入的计数初值为独立编址方式。3. RS-232C接口标准采用“负逻辑”标准,规定:数据“0”为 +5+15_;数据“ 1”为-5-15 。4. CPU与 I/O设备之间传送的信号一般有数据信号,控制信号,状态信号。5. 对存储器进行读/写时,地址线被分为片选地址 和_片内地址_两部分,他们分别用以产生芯片选择信 号和_片内存储单元选择 _信号。6. 若采用中断方式从 ADC0809读取数据时,ADC0809向CPU发出中断请求的信号是 _ EOQ。五、简答题 (1, 2每小题5分,第3题7;共17 分)1. 简述CPU对INTR饿中断响应条件?答:一条

11、指令执行完;当前无NMI非屏蔽中断请求;无 HOLD总线请求;INTR请求信号有效;中断允许标志位IF=12. 下面是某一 0832的转换程序,端口为 200H,请根据程序回答下面问题。MOV AL,0MOV DX,200HDOWN : OUT DX,ALCMP AL,0FFHJNZ AL,DOWNUP : OUT DX,ALDEC ALCMP AL ,0JNZ UPJMP DOWN问:(1)该0832工作在何种方式下? 工作在单缓冲方式下;程序完成的功能是什么?试画出其转换图形。其图形如下: 完成三角波信号的输出3. 某串行异步通信接口传送标准ASCII字符,约定1位奇偶校验位,2位停止位,

12、请回答:(1)如果在接收端收到数据波形如下图,则所传送字符的代码是多少? 字符代码是53H;如果传输的波特率为 9600,问每秒钟最多可传送多少个字符。 采用奇校验;。872个字符五、解答题(第一题8分,第二题12分;共20分)1.64K X 8b的RAM芯片构成256KB的存储器,试求:a、画出该存储器的结构图;b、写出各芯片片选信号的有效地址1、由于芯片容量是 2KX 8位,所以每片芯片有 11根地址线(A0-A10) , 8根数据线(D0-D7)根据要求,可 以列出各芯片的始末地址如下:芯片 0: 4000H-47FFH芯片 1 : 4800H-4FFFH芯片 2: 5000H-57FF

13、H芯片 3: 5800H-5FFFH参考图形如下:1. 设8254的端口地址为0240H 0243H,通道0的输入CLK频率为1MHz,为使通道0输出1KHz的方波,编写初始化程序。如果在不增加其他硬件芯片的条件下要得到1s定时,该如何实现,并写出初始化程序。(8254的方式控制命令字如下)通道0的输入始终频率是 1MHZ为使通道0得到1kHz的方波,所以通道 0应工作在方式3。1MHz/1KHz=1000为初值OUT1端要每隔1ms输出一个50us的负脉冲,计数通道 1应工作在方式2, 必须输入周期为 50us的时钟脉冲,计数初值为1ms/50us=20 ;因此在通道0要产生50us的方波,定义计数通道 0工作方式为3,计数初值为:50us/1us=50MOV DX 243MOV AL, 00010110HOUT DX, ALOUT DX, ALMOV DX 243HMOV AL, 01010100HOUT DX, MOV AX, 20OUT DX, AL

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 社会民生


经营许可证编号:宁ICP备18001539号-1